How much do data entry in j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 7, 2026, the average hourly pay for data entry in in Lancaster, PA is $18.93,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.87 and $21.25 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What exactly do data entry jobs do?

Data entry jobs involve inputting, updating, and managing information in computer systems or databases. Workers typically use tools like spreadsheets and data management software, and accuracy and attention to detail are essential skills for this role.

Is data entry well paid?

Data entry jobs typically offer hourly wages that are close to minimum wage or slightly above, with pay varying based on experience, location, and complexity of tasks. Advanced skills, such as proficiency with specific software or fast typing speeds, can lead to higher pay. Overall, data entry is generally considered an entry-level position with moderate pay.

What are some common challenges faced in a data entry in, and how can they be effectively managed?

Data Entry professionals often encounter challenges such as handling large volumes of repetitive information, maintaining high accuracy, and meeting tight deadlines. To manage these effectively, it's important to develop strong attention to detail, establish efficient workflows, and take regular breaks to reduce fatigue and maintain focus. Utilizing keyboard shortcuts and data management tools can also help streamline the process and minimize errors, ensuring that data is entered quickly and accurately.

Job description

Job Title: Data Entry ClerkJob Description

The Data Entry Clerk is responsible for accurately inputting, updating, and maintaining technical data across various systems and platforms. This role supports multiple departments by ensuring data integrity, generating reports, and responding to data-related inquiries within a manufacturing office environment.

Responsibilities
  • Interpret family drawings and bill of materials (BOM) information and accurately enter and update data into databases, spreadsheets, and internal systems.
  • Verify the accuracy and completeness of information before inputting data into any system.
  • Perform regular data audits to identify errors, inconsistencies, or missing information, and correct issues promptly.
  • Maintain confidentiality and security of sensitive information in accordance with company policies and best practices.
  • Generate reports and summaries as needed to support internal stakeholders and operational decision-making.
  • Collaborate with other departments to ensure data consistency and alignment across systems and processes.
  • Respond to data-related inquiries from internal teams and resolve discrepancies in a timely and professional manner.
  • Adapt to changing priorities and adjust work focus as needed to support business requirements.
  • Perform other related duties as assigned to support the overall efficiency and accuracy of data management.
Essential Skills
  • Proven data entry experience, including working with technical data in an administrative support or data entry capacity.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office, particularly Excel, for data input, manipulation, and reporting.
  • Ability to read and interpret drawings, schematics, and blueprints to accurately capture and enter technical information.
  • Strong attention to detail with a focus on accuracy, consistency, and data quality.
  • Good communication skills with the ability to interact effectively with other departments and respond to data-related inquiries.
  • Ability and willingness to work as a team player in a collaborative environment.
  • Demonstrated ability to adapt to changing priorities and manage multiple tasks efficiently.
Additional Skills & Qualifications
  • Experience working with ERP systems; familiarity with Sage ERP is a strong plus.
  • Knowledge of bill of materials (BOM) structures and manufacturing-related documentation.
  • Comfort working with technical documentation such as drawings, schematics, and blueprints.
  • Prior experience in a manufacturing or industrial office environment is beneficial.
  • Strong organizational skills and the ability to maintain structured and well-documented records.
Work Environment

This position is based in the office section of a manufacturing facility, with limited time spent on the production floor. The standard schedule is Monday through Friday, 7:00 a.m. to 3:30 p.m. The role involves working primarily at a computer using Microsoft Office and an ERP system (Sage) to manage data. Personal protective equipment (PPE) is provided when it is necessary to enter the production floor. The dress code is business casual, with jeans acceptable and closed-toe shoes required. The environment is collaborative and focused on accuracy, data integrity, and supporting manufacturing operations through reliable information management.
